In principle the dosing happens everywhere there where
a selected quantity has to be manufactured.
This can come upon in any industry in any appliance.
Some examples for this purpose:
+ Dosing from bulk freight
++ Loading from material in trucks, rail, ship,...
++ Rate of stoves (biomass power plants, blast furnaces,...)
++ Dosing in container (e.g. centrifugals for further converting from a
material)
+ Dosing from liquids
++ Dosing from chemistry for conditioning of industrial water or
sewage, of triggered cellulose for paper machines
++ Dosing from process or industrial water for the watering of compost
++ Dosing from mash in fermenting silos
+ Dosing of aerially media
++ injection of air in fermenting silos

The terms and definitions mixing and dosing are different in the kind
of use. At dosing a defined quantity is merged as result.
Thus nothing other than to prepare by a recipe a product.
For mixing from media a recipe is needed as specification. In this
recipe are the articles and whose needed quantities indicated.

There is thus a parameter, index value how much mass has to be charged
in a object and a sensor, which comprise the current quantity.
The material is dosed in a scale, until the parameter agree on the
actual value.
In OPICOM the tolerance can be input and changed, which size
varied naturally according to article and quantity unit.
We tune the installation accurately.
The change-over point for the fine dosing is keyed.
The pre-threshold is every time recalculated, because by every
article, according to thermal/cold/charge of the silos, the dump speed can
change.
This guarantees that the desired quantity as accurately as possible is
dosed! In the recipe administration can be input rather is allocated,
which article in which scale has to be dosed. It is accurate detained,
in which silo (with ID-number), what and how much is contained.
Beside the actual recipe, which is basically always the same, the
machine parameters are configured, that are special
settings for construction. It is deposited what advances in addition
to the recipe. For example, here are the batch size, the water addition, which
mixer when has to be choosed, mixing times or/and index value times of
pumps/screws keyed.

In the containers the needed materials are dosed according to recipe.
From scales the articles comes to the default mixer.
There the articles are admixed and after they will be discharged for further use.
This can be a a new dosing for a next mixer, pressing of pellets,
a storage or a dosing for a loading or filling.
